Building Knowledge That Saves Lives
Our presentations are designed to provide practical, age-appropriate information that young people can use in real-world situations.
Topics included:
- Understanding fentanyl
- Counterfeit pills and look-alike medications
- Overdose prevention
- Harm reduction principles
- Recognizing warning signs
- Responding in an emergency
- Accessing trusted resources and support
